Introduction

Engineering includes many subcategories.

Electrical, civil, and mechanical, to name a few. A set of fundamental concepts governs all these. Our program provides a clear understanding of the fundamentals and opportunities to apply them to solve problems. Once you are comfortable with the fundamentals, you can build upon them and be successful in any engineering field.

Engineering is strongly linked with environmental, economic, social, and political contexts, so a broad knowledge of engineering and a strong liberal arts background will be helpful in your career. It is a special skill to communicate between specialities, a skill that many specialists don't have, but you will develop this skill in your coursework.

Many students arrive at Cornell anticipating that they will go into a specific type of engineering. After several years of coursework and internships, their interests often change. At Cornell, students are not set back like they would be if they chose a speciality. They do not need to change majors or take other introductory courses; instead, they continue on the path to graduate in four years.
